Graduate Degrees
Continue your education journey and pursue professional excellence with a master’s degree.
Earn a Master of Education (M.Ed.) or a Master of Arts (M.A.) in Education through the Dreeben School of Education. Our master's degree programs prepare students for academic and professional expertise in a variety of specialized concentrations. Rigorous coursework and experiential learning opportunities are hallmarks of this dynamic program. Exceptional faculty work to educate, inspire and mold well-rounded students.
An evening schedule offers flexibility, helping meet the needs of working professionals hoping to advance their careers and better serve learners in a variety of fields. An academic advisor dedicated to graduate students also provides support and guidance through graduation.
